Я пытаюсь зафиксировать и откатить транзакции с помощью адаптера таблицы.У меня есть следующий код:
try {
MyTableAdapters.MyableAdapter contTa = new MyTableAdapters.MyableAdapter();
contTa.Connection.BeginTransaction();
contTa.InsertSP(myvalues);
contTa.Transaction.Commit();
}
catch {
contTa.Transaction.Rollback();
}
однако он показывает ошибку, что объект не инициализирован, я не уверен, что я делаю неправильно.
Команда вставки являетсяХранимая процедура, которую я должен использовать для получения идентификатора вновь вставленных значений.
При использовании отладчика ошибка отображается на contTa.Connection.BeginTransaction();